Holistic Care Approach
Our Approach
We believe children thrive when they feel emotionally secure and understood. Our work is child-centred, individualised, and grounded in developmental best practice. Each child receives tailored support delivered with care, consistency, and professionalism.
Our Environment
Our centre is thoughtfully designed to be sensory-friendly and calming. Warm lighting, natural tones, and predictable spaces help children feel regulated and comfortable across all settings.
Working With Families
Families are active partners in the developmental process. We prioritise clear communication, regular progress updates, and practical home-based strategies to support development beyond the centre.
Our Commitment
We are committed to ethical practice, professional integrity, and compassionate care—supporting children’s development in a safe, respectful, and emotionally supportive environment.
